Quoted:
Quoted:
Thank you! Yes its a rifle length tube alright, i am seriously considering a piston upgrade though.


Wow I bet that thing is a soft shooter! If you haven't had cycling troubles piston is a waste of money. If you have had cycling issues just open up the gas port a little. Also the reason the eotech needs to be further forward is it is easier to find the reticle and it increases field of view. It is all really just down to personal preference tho.


That and give a little more room to access the controls. Its still personal preference though. I run mine with the battery compartment   forward of the receiver with the hood directly above the mag well. Its easy to pick up the reticle, good access to the controls and balances on the gun well. That stock you have is quite heavy (I have the same) and moving the site forward will help add a little balance to your rifle.
